Northern Trust Corporation (Nasdaq: NTRS) is a leading provider of wealth management, asset servicing, asset management and banking to corporations, institutions, affluent families and individuals. Founded in Chicago in 1889, Northern Trust has a global presence with offices in 25 U.S. states and Washington, D.C., and across 23 locations in Canada, Europe, the Middle East and the Asia-Pacific region. As of September 30, 2022, Northern Trust had assets under custody/administration of US$12.8 trillion, and assets under management of US$1.2 trillion. For more than 130 years, Northern Trust has earned distinction as an industry leader for exceptional service, financial expertise, integrity and innovation.

BankersLab is a leader in learning innovation that specializes in building award-winning “flight simulators” for bankers. We are an innovative group passionate about creating a dynamic learning environment for retail lenders.
BankersLab® offers a suite of simulation-based consumer lending training products. Each of our multi-day courses is run in a classroom setting and transforms the learner into a player. During the course, teams have to demonstrate expertise in specific areas such as managing retail portfolios, optimizing delinquent collections or using credit scores – with the aim of operating the most profitable virtual bank. By playing a Lab simulation game, learners can gain decades of additional ‘experience’ in a virtual setting.

Visa Inc. is an American multinational financial services corporation headquartered in Foster City, California, United States.[3] It facilitates electronic funds transfers throughout the world, most commonly through Visa-branded credit cards and debit cards.[4] Visa does not issue cards, extend credit or set rates and fees for consumers; rather, Visa provides financial institutions with Visa-branded payment products that they then use to offer credit, debit, prepaid and cash-access programs to their customers. In 2015, the Nilson Report, a publication that tracks the credit card industry, found that Visa’s global network (known as VisaNet) processed 100 billion transactions with a total volume of US$6.8 trillion.
